I heard an article in New Scientist a short while back. It was on touch 
screens, and explained their might be problems on the horizon.

They at presently use a compound containing Tin and Indium. It is the element 
Indium that is rather rare, estimated availability of 16,000 tons left on 
planet Earth. There might not be enough for a new revolution.

The tin/Indium compound is just at the limit of conductance for the screen to 
work. Their are other compounds that are better, with respect to conductance, 
however they are not as transparent as the Tin/Indium. Of course, research is 
furiously taking place to find another compound meeting the conductance and 
transparency specifications, made of elements that are not so rare as Indium.
